Students corner chancellor - SA
Pretoria - The Tshwane University of Technology's vice-chancellor was escorted from the Soshanguve campus by police on Friday afternoon after clashes between police and students.

Vice-chancellor Reggie Ngcobo was confined to the administration building by protesting students for about 30 minutes until freed by police, who used stun grenades.

"About 500 students prevented him from leaving the building for about half-an-hour from 15:00," said police spokesperson Inspector Piletji Sebola.
